"Somewhere I belong?" A study on transnational identity shifts caused by "double stigmatization" among Chinese international student returnees during COVID-19 through the lens of mindsponge mechanism.

Abstract

Chinese international students who studied in the United States received "double stigmatization" from American and Chinese authorities because of the "political othering" tactic during COVID-19. The research used a phenomenological approach to examine why and how specifically the transnational identity of Chinese international students in the United States shifted during the double stigmatization. The researcher conducted a total of three rounds of interviews with 15 Chinese international students who studied in the United States and returned to China between 2018 and 2020, which culminated in 45 interviews through a longitudinal study to probe the transnational identities of this population before and during the double stigmatization; the study also examined how the mindsponge mechanism worked during the identity shifts and the interplay among stigmatization, transnational identity shifts, and the mindsponge mechanism. The study concluded that before COVID-19, Chinese international students had been stigmatized in both China and the United States. And there were three identity clusters for international students' transnational identity: homestayers, wayfarers, and navigators based on four dimensions: intercultural competence, relocation of locality, diaspora consciousness, and attachment between China and the US. The study concluded that during the double stigmatization, Chinese international students in all three identity clusters took individualism into their core values, whereas Chinese traditional values, such as nationalism, collectivism, and obedience to authority waned. In addition, the study corroborated the trust evaluator's gatekeeper role and substantiated the validity and effectiveness of cost-benefit analysis on an individual's decision to accept or reject new information and values.

摘要

在美国学习的中国留学生在新冠疫情期间因“政治他者化”策略受到美国和中国当局的“双重污名化”。该研究采用现象学方法,探讨在美国的中国留学生在双重污名化期间其跨国身份为何以及如何具体发生转变。研究人员对15名在2018年至2020年间在美国学习并返回中国的中国留学生进行了三轮访谈,通过纵向研究最终形成45次访谈,以探究这一群体在双重污名化之前和期间的跨国身份;该研究还考察了在身份转变过程中思维海绵机制是如何运作的,以及污名化、跨国身份转变和思维海绵机制之间的相互作用。研究得出结论,在新冠疫情之前,中国留学生在中国和美国都受到了污名化。基于跨文化能力、地域迁移、侨民意识以及中美之间的情感纽带这四个维度,留学生的跨国身份存在三个身份集群:留居者、行者和领航者。研究得出结论,在双重污名化期间,所有三个身份集群的中国留学生都将个人主义纳入其核心价值观,而诸如民族主义、集体主义和服从权威等中国传统价值观则有所减弱。此外,该研究证实了信任评估者的把关人角色,并证实了成本效益分析在个人接受或拒绝新信息和价值观决策方面的有效性和实效性。
